Lynne L. Lewis “Rowhouses, UK” 1994 Signed Original Watercolor

Original watercolor painting by Lynne L. Lewis (American, late 20th century), titled “Rowhouses, UK.” Signed and dated 1994 at lower right, the work captures a row of brightly painted English terraced houses beneath a stormy sky, with a solitary figure adding depth and atmosphere. Lewis’s confident line work and vibrant use of color highlight her characteristic treatment of light and shadow within architectural settings.

Presented under glass in a white frame with lavender matting. Artist and framer labels remain affixed to the reverse, including Museum Quality Framing documentation dated 2020. A charming and skillfully rendered streetscape by a noted regional watercolorist.

Condition

Good overall. Artwork remains clean and vibrant with no visible fading or stains. Frame shows minor corner dings and light handling wear. Backing paper, labels, and hanging wire intact.


Dimensions

Overall: 9.25" x 11.25"
Visible (sight): 4.5" x 6.5"


Artist Biography

Lynne L. Lewis is an American watercolor artist recognized for her vivid depictions of architectural and landscape subjects. Active from the late 20th century onward, Lewis has produced numerous small-format watercolors that reflect both urban and rural inspirations, often influenced by travels in the United Kingdom and Europe. Based in the Pacific Northwest, she has exhibited regionally and is known for her bright color palette and expressive, plein-air technique. Her works are held in private collections across the U.S.
